- - - - -
-
-
- - - +
+
+ + + + +
+
+
+ + + +
+
用户账号
-
用户账号
-
-
- -
-
- - -
-
-
- - - +
+
-
用户密码
-
-
-
-
- - -
-
-
- - - + + +
+
+
+ + + +
+
用户密码
+
+
+
-
确认密码
-
-
-
-
- - -
-
-
- - - + + +
+
+
+ + + +
+
确认密码
+
+
+
-
姓名
-
- + + +
+
+
+ + + +
+
姓名
+
+
+ +
-
-
+ - -
-
-
- - - + +
+
+
+ + + +
+
班级
-
班级
-
-
- -
-
- - - -
-
-
- - - +
+
-
学号
-
-
-
-
- - -
-
-
- - - + + + +
+
+
+ + + +
+
学号
+
+
+
-
手机号
-
-
-
-
- - -
-
-
- - - + + +
+
+
+ + + +
+
手机号
+
+
+
-
验证码
-
-
- -
- + + +
+
+
+ + + +
+
验证码
+
+
+
+ +
+ +
-
- - - - 注册 - - - 返回到登录页 - - - - - - - -
-
-
- - - + + + +
+
+
+ + + +
+
用户名
-
用户名
-
-
- -
-
- - -
-
-
- - - +
+
-
学号
-
-
-
-
- - -
-
-
- - - + + +
+
+
+ + + +
+
学号
+
+
+
-
密码
-
-
-
-
- - -
-
-
- - - + + +
+
+
+ + + +
+
密码
+
+
+
-
验证码
-
-
- -
- + + +
+
+
+ + + +
+
验证码
+
+
+
+ +
+ +
-
- - - - - 登录 - 去注册 - - - - - + + 登录 + 去注册 + + + + + +
@@ -404,16 +409,8 @@ const register = async () => { getcodeinfo() } - // getcodeinfo() - - // console.log(11111); - - // ElMessage.warning(res.message) - - - // console.log(res) }; const codeUrl = ref(""); const getcodeinfo = async () => { @@ -422,11 +419,6 @@ const getcodeinfo = async () => { console.log(codeUrl.value); }; getcodeinfo(); -// import { useRouter } from 'vue-router' -// const router = useRouter() -// const goToPage=()=>{ -// router.push('/') -// } // 登录 const login = async () => { await formRef.value.validate(); @@ -450,6 +442,10 @@ const toLogin = () => { isRegister.value = false getcodeinfo(); } + +const clickErrorBtn=()=>{ + console.log('aaa'); +} \ No newline at end of file diff --git a/src/layout/studyPage.vue b/src/layout/studyPage.vue new file mode 100644 index 0000000..9d2ec13 --- /dev/null +++ b/src/layout/studyPage.vue @@ -0,0 +1,156 @@ + + + + + \ No newline at end of file diff --git a/src/router/index.ts b/src/router/index.ts index a94bfbb..e9d09e4 100644 --- a/src/router/index.ts +++ b/src/router/index.ts @@ -37,11 +37,29 @@ const routerList: any = [ name: 'SubjectTest', component: () => import('@/views/subjectTest/index.vue'), }, + { + path: '/target', // 实验目标(简介) + name: 'Target', + component: () => import('@/views/target/index.vue'), + }, { path: '/login', name: 'Login', component: () => import('@/layout/loginPage.vue') }, + { + path:'/studyPage', + name:'StudyPage', + component: () => import('@/layout/studyPage.vue') + },{ + path: '/spacePage', + name: 'SpacePage', + component:()=>import('@/layout/spacePage.vue') + },{ + path: '/knowledgePage', + name: 'KnowledgePage', + component: () => import('@/layout/knowledgePage.vue') + }, ]; diff --git a/src/views/largeDataScreen/home.vue b/src/views/largeDataScreen/home.vue index 1716593..bddb4a7 100644 --- a/src/views/largeDataScreen/home.vue +++ b/src/views/largeDataScreen/home.vue @@ -490,7 +490,21 @@ Instruments将在遵循保密协议的前提下,使用您的搜索查询来改进搜索结果和相关性。
-
+
+
产品通知
+
请查看所选配置的相关信息。
+
+ 安装须知:本协议具合同效力。在你方下载软件和/或完成软件安装过程之前,请仔细阅读本协议。一旦你方下载和/或点击相应的按钮,从而完成软件安装过程,即表示你方同意本协议条款并愿意受本协议的约束。若你方不愿意成为本协议的当事方,并不接受本协议所有条款和条件的约束,请点击相应的按钮取消安装过程,即不要安装或使用软件,并在收到软件之日起三十(30)日内将软件(及所有随附书面材料及其包装)退还至获取该软件的地点,所有退还事宜都应遵守退还发生时适用的NI退还政策。.com/info,并输入信息代码expm69查询。 +
定义 在本协议中,下列术语的含义如下本National Instruments许可适用于软件LabVIEW 204 +
+
+ + 我接受上述2条许可协议。 + 我不接受某些许可协议。 + +
+
+

总进度

复制新文件

-
+

总进度